The average bus between Leeds and Broxbourne takes 8h 5m and the fastest bus takes 5h 18m. The bus service runs several times per day from Leeds to Broxbourne.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 5 times a day between Leeds and Broxbourne. The earliest departure is at 12:05 AM at night, and the last departure from Leeds is at 7:00 PM which arrives into Broxbourne at 6:48 AM. All services require a transfer at Milton Keynes Coachway and take an average of 8h 5m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Leeds to Broxbourne. However, there are services departing from Leeds station and arriving at Broxbourne station via Milton Keynes Coachway.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 5m.
Leeds to Broxbourne b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Leeds City Bus & Coach Station.
Leeds to Broxbourne b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Tesco station.
The distance between Leeds and Broxbourne is 250 km. The road distance is 327 km.
You can take a bus from Leeds City Bus & Coach Station to Station Road via Milton Keynes Coachway and Tesco in around 7h 58m.
